New CC Extensions - DataBridge just hangs at mid point.

Managed to install the new CC eCart Extension ZXP but it really took forever. Same with Free Tools, however when I disabled my Anti Virus (Windows Defender it installed - althought still took ages). However when it has come to DataBridge been 2 hours now trying to install it. Hangs at mid point.

Windows 8 64 Bit OS. Ironically Extend Studio Extensions installed without any issues at all. Only the WA ones seem to be an issue. It is not a case of not responding. There is CPU activity and memory useage althought minimal disc useage during the install. But obviously it is too long for some reason.

Any ideas or suggestions?
Attach Screenshot of Hanging (Its been at this point now for 1 and half hours and Task Manager referencing Adobe Extensions Manager.

Thanks in advance for your help

Problems with windows 8 64 bits

I have the same problem as you. I had this problem with windows 8 64 bits and dreamweaver cs6 too.
I solved this running dreamweaver cs6 and extension mamager cs6 as administrador, and its runs.

This time i canĀ“t run extension manager as administrador because the cc version crashs :(. I think that webassist extension have problems with windows 8, because i have a labtop and i have the same problems too, and i tried even formating the computer.

maybe if you try running it as administrator works for you

I have managed to install all WA extensions in Dreamweaver CC today through the Extension Manager. However, they all took ages. I'm running Windows 8 64 bit. It took several hours to install all of them and at times it looked like nothing was going on, but I just left it and eventually each one installed. My advice is to give a LONG time to finish installing each extension. Hopefully WA will have fixes for these issues soon - don't fancy waiting 2 hours per extension uninstall/reinstall for future updates.
